I'm liking these puzzle ideas!
I'll elaborate some more in your feedback post, but in short: This is some really solid puzzle design! I had to use some real brainpower to figure out how to use the blocks. The setup of the given staircase is a great way of tricking the player into thinking you have to use it, when I figured out a more efficient way of doing things.
Great work!